Monday, July 6, 2015. A Week at Watch Lake, BC. The children and I arrived at supper time. The thunder rolled when we got out of my car and there was the faint smell of campfire—smoke that probably drifted from across the lake somewhere. I offered to set the table and we had hamburgers, but not the kind you're thinking about. We used mashed potatoes instead of buns.
